Liverpool Echo Arena - and surrounding area

Hi I am going to the Supercross event tomorrow, never been to Liverpool before, so need a few tips please.

I need to collect tickets from the box office, so may get these late afternoon. Is there free car parking at the arena, if so I can leave the car and have a walk around the docks area.

Where is a good place to eat? Will be two adults and a ten year old, so somewhere serving pasta or pizza probably good!

    My OH and my son are going too :)

    There is parking at Echo - a multiple storey car park or parking opposite near the Premier Inn/Albert Dock area. I think the multiple storey will probably be cheapest.

    There's loads of places to eat at Albert Dock and a Pizza Express directly opposite the box office.

    the multistorey carpark is great as its next to the arena and im sure its £4 to park if your going to the arena.
    L1- nandos, gormet burger, waggamamas, ask or albert dock loads of restaurants like blue bar, haha bar, gustos, pan american.
